The Advantages and Disadvantages of Democracies

A democracy is a type of government in which the people have the power to make decisions and deliberate on laws. The government is made up of elected officials who are chosen by the people. This system allows the people to participate in the creation of legislation and the decision-making process. While a democracy has its challenges, it has several positive traits.
